About 1-[(4aR,8R,8aS)-4-butyl-8-pyrrolidin-1-yl-2,3,4a,5,6,7,8,8a-octahydroquinoxalin-1-yl]-2-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)ethanone

1-[(4aR,8R,8aS)-4-butyl-8-pyrrolidin-1-yl-2,3,4a,5,6,7,8,8a-octahydroquinoxalin-1-yl]-2-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)ethanone (PubChem CID 86581568) has the molecular formula C24H35Cl2N3O and a molecular weight of 452.47 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[(4aR,8R,8aS)-4-butyl-8-pyrrolidin-1-yl-2,3,4a,5,6,7,8,8a-octahydroquinoxalin-1-yl]-2-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)ethanone.
